jdillon 2003/08/29 05:37:36
Modified: . maven.xml
modules/twiddle/src/bin twiddle twiddle.bat
Log:
o Hooked up RMIClassLoaderSpiImpl to handle spaces in directories problem
Revision Changes Path
1.29 +4 -3 incubator-geronimo/maven.xml
Index: maven.xml
===================================================================
RCS file: /home/cvs/incubator-geronimo/maven.xml,v
retrieving revision 1.28
retrieving revision 1.29
diff -u -r1.28 -r1.29
--- maven.xml 27 Aug 2003 20:40:51 -0000 1.28
+++ maven.xml 29 Aug 2003 12:37:35 -0000 1.29
@@ -376,12 +376,13 @@
<classpath>
<pathelement location="${run.dir}/lib/classworlds-SNAPSHOT.jar"/>
+ <pathelement location="${run.dir}/lib/geronimo-core-rmiclassloaderspi.jar"/>
</classpath>
<sysproperty key="classworlds.conf" value="${run.dir}/etc/classworlds.conf"/>
<sysproperty key="program.name" value="maven:run"/>
<sysproperty key="twiddle.home" value="${run.dir}"/>
-
+ <sysproperty key="java.rmi.server.RMIClassLoaderSpi" value="org.apache.geronimo.rmi.RMIClassLoaderSpiImpl"/>
<arg value="geronimo/start"/>
</java>
</j:jelly>
@@ -410,7 +411,7 @@
<sysproperty key="program.name" value="maven:run"/>
<sysproperty key="geronimo.home" value="file:${run.dir}/"/>
-
+ <sysproperty key="java.rmi.server.RMIClassLoaderSpi" value="org.apache.geronimo.rmi.RMIClassLoaderSpiImpl"/>
</java>
</j:jelly>
</goal>
1.4 +3 -2 incubator-geronimo/modules/twiddle/src/bin/twiddle
Index: twiddle
===================================================================
RCS file: /home/cvs/incubator-geronimo/modules/twiddle/src/bin/twiddle,v
retrieving revision 1.3
retrieving revision 1.4
diff -u -r1.3 -r1.4
--- twiddle 26 Aug 2003 10:38:26 -0000 1.3
+++ twiddle 29 Aug 2003 12:37:35 -0000 1.4
@@ -59,7 +59,7 @@
if [ -z "$CLASSWORLDS_CONF" ]; then
CLASSWORLDS_CONF="$TWIDDLE_HOME/etc/classworlds.conf"
fi
-CLASSWORLDS_CLASSPATH="$TWIDDLE_HOME/lib/classworlds-${CLASSWORLDS_VERSION}.jar"
+CLASSWORLDS_CLASSPATH="$TWIDDLE_HOME/lib/classworlds-${CLASSWORLDS_VERSION}.jar:$TWIDDLE_HOME/lib/geronimo-core-rmiclassloaderspi.jar"
# Determine the Java command to use to start the JVM
if [ -z "$JAVACMD" ]; then
@@ -135,5 +135,6 @@
-Dclassworlds.conf="$CLASSWORLDS_CONF" \
-Dtwiddle.home="$TWIDDLE_HOME" \
-Dtools.jar="$TOOLS_JAR" \
+ -Djava.rmi.server.RMIClassLoaderSpi=org.apache.geronimo.rmi.RMIClassLoaderSpiImpl
\
com.werken.classworlds.Launcher "$@"
fi
1.3 +3 -2 incubator-geronimo/modules/twiddle/src/bin/twiddle.bat
Index: twiddle.bat
===================================================================
RCS file: /home/cvs/incubator-geronimo/modules/twiddle/src/bin/twiddle.bat,v
retrieving revision 1.2
retrieving revision 1.3
diff -u -r1.2 -r1.3
--- twiddle.bat 26 Aug 2003 10:38:26 -0000 1.2
+++ twiddle.bat 29 Aug 2003 12:37:35 -0000 1.3
@@ -84,7 +84,7 @@
:execute
@rem Setup the command line
-set CLASSWORLDS_CLASSPATH=%TWIDDLE_HOME%\lib\classworlds-%CLASSWORLDS_VERSION%.jar
+set CLASSWORLDS_CLASSPATH=%TWIDDLE_HOME%\lib\classworlds-%CLASSWORLDS_VERSION%.jar;%TWIDDLE_HOME%\lib\geronimo-core-rmiclassloaderspi.jar
set CLASSWORLDS_MAIN_CLASS=com.werken.classworlds.Launcher
set CLASSWORLDS_CONF=%TWIDDLE_HOME%\etc\classworlds.conf
@@ -96,6 +96,7 @@
set JAVA_OPTS=%JAVA_OPTS% -Dtwiddle.home="%TWIDDLE_HOME%"
set JAVA_OPTS=%JAVA_OPTS% -Dtools.jar="%TOOLS_JAR%"
set JAVA_OPTS=%JAVA_OPTS% -Dclassworlds.conf="%CLASSWORLDS_CONF%"
+set JAVA_OPTS=%JAVA_OPTS% -Djava.rmi.server.RMIClassLoaderSpi=org.apache.geronimo.rmi.RMIClassLoaderSpiImpl
@rem Execute Twiddle
"%JAVA_EXE%" %JAVA_OPTS% -classpath "%CLASSWORLDS_CLASSPATH%" %CLASSWORLDS_MAIN_CLASS%
%CMD_LINE_ARGS%
|